Abstract
Equality between women and men has been given special consideration into the EU law since Article 119 establishing equal pay in the European Community Treaty became the legal basis for directives and judgments of the Court of Justice. This opened the path to greater equality in a wide range of areas (social security, work-life balance, access to employment, professional advancement, and so on). Thus, with the Treaty of Amsterdam, the European Community Treaty was amended to incorporate equality in the workplace and in working conditions, positive actions and, especially, to make equality a transversal issue that, according to Articles 2 and 3 of the same Treaty, should govern all Community policies as an objective and as a means of action. This way, a body of implementing legislation and Community case-law arose providing the basis for progress in equality not only within the EU but also in each of its Member States. The Court of Justice of the Union has played an important role in this development, simultaneously to the European Court of Human Rights within the context of the Council of Europe, whose legislation was, in any case, already embedded in the European acquis thanks to Article 6 of the Treaty on European Union according to which the rights guaranteed by the European Convention on Human Rights form part of Union law as general principles. In light of the above, this entry will analyze all the legal development of gender equality in European law.
